After that, the two of them eventually fell silent, not knowing what else to say. At the same time, the people around were still talking about the dolphins. As she noticed that Roger didn't respond for a long time, Rachel wondered if she had been too harsh on him. “Rog...” She moved her lips to call him, wondering if she should say something to at least ease the tension

However, before she could say anything, a gentle smile suddenly appeared on Roger's face. “You don't need to say anything. I know,” he said calmly. Rachel was stunned, not expecting what he said. “Then why...” “Two years ago, when I saw the smile on your face when you said that you were going to marry Victor, I knew that he was the only one in your heart. However, even though I accepted that, I couldn't get myself to give up on you.

In fact, I had been lying to myself the whole time, convincing myself that you only married him because I didn't make any move back then.” Roger sighed deeply and let out a bitter smile. “I actually thought of finally letting go of you. When I came back from abroad and learned that you were pregnant with his child, I told myself that it might be the right time.” Meanwhile, Rachel pursed her lips, said nothing, and just listened. Roger chuckled as if mocking himself.

“But guess what? I still couldn't. Since the first time I saw you in high school, I fell deeply in love with you. However, it was only until years had passed when I finally realized that. Unfortunately, it was too late. I really wanted to let go, but my feelings for you are buried too deep inside my heart.” When the maid heard Roger's confession, she couldn't help but take a deep breath before looking at Rachel's face. She really thought that Rachel would be moved by Roger's heartfelt speech.

But to her surprise, she didn’t seem to be touched at all. The maid couldn't help but be taken aback. If a man like Roger confessed his love to her so affectionately, she knew that she would instantly get choked with her own tears. Then, she would run in his arms without any hesitation. On the other hand, Rachel remained very calm, as if what Roger had said meant nothing to her. To be exact, she couldn't feel anything about it.

“Rachel, you don't need to react. I'm not asking for an answer,” Roger explained, worried that Rachel might take it the wrong way. “You don't need to feel burdened. Just think of it as me finally saying the things I had been dying to say. But still, I mean what I said just now. If you are unhappy with him, just say the word.

I can take you away. I know it is impossible for you to fall in love with me at once, and I know how hard it is to let go of someone you've loved for a long time. But I can wait. I can wait for you to get over him and accept my feelings.” Roger stared intently into her eyes, trying to read what was on her mind. Hearing this, Rachel sighed inwardly, knowing that her words were not ruthless enough to let Roger down. “I'm sorry, Roger. You think it is okay? That I don't need to feel burdened? But I do feel burdened about it.”

Hearing this unexpected answer, Roger was stunned. “Let me get this straight. Roger, your love is a burden to me.” Rachel continued to break his heart, clenching her fists tightly.

"I don't care if you can get over me or not, but I don't think we should talk or see each other again. I want absolutely nothing between us. I just came to see you today to say this.” Roger swallowed hard. It was as if he was having a nightmare. He couldn't utter a word. Rachel's words were like sharp knives repeatedly stabbing his heart, making it hard for him to breathe of course, Rachel instantly saw how Roger's face turned pale. She had to admit that this time, she tried to hurt him as much as she could. Rachel took a deep breath to calm herself down before she spoke again.

“I think I've made myself clear. Now, please excuse me. I need to go.” “Rachel, wait!” Roger called out in his hoarse voice. Seeing that she was about to leave, he came to his senses and quickly grabbed her wrist. However, as Roger stopped Rachel from leaving, someone suddenly appeared and hurriedly approached Roger.

Bam!

The next second, Roger was punched hard right in his face. He was caught off guard, not expecting that someone would suddenly hit him. As he staggered backward, his grip on Rachel's wrist loosened. Even Rachel was completely dumbfounded when she saw the man who punched Roger. With a cold and dark expression, Victor stood in front of Roger with clenched fists. The veins on his temples bulged slightly, and the aura around him was terrifying Nobody knew when he showed up in this place. In fact, even Rachel didn't hear that he was coming towards them.

At this time, blood trickled down from the corner of Roger's mouth. As soon as he stood firm and wiped the blood with his hand, Victor came at him again. However, Roger was standing right by the railing. If he was hit by Victor again, he might fall off the ship “Roger, watch out!” Rachel shouted anxiously.
